Bank of Korea holds rate steady; inflation remains below target

Bloomberg The Bank of Korea left its key interest rate unchanged as inflation remains below target and the nation’s currency trades near a multi-year high. The unanimous decision to keep the seven-day repurchase rate at 1.5 percent, in the next-to-last rate decision before Governor Lee Ju-yeol’s term ends in March, was forecast by all 17 analysts surveyed by Bloomberg. Credit Suisse plans bonus pool increase for 2017

Bloomberg Credit Suisse Group AG, Switzerland’s second-largest bank, plans to increase its bonus pool for last year as the lender makes progress on its three-year restructuring plan, two people familiar with the plans said. Steinhoff sells private jet to broker Avpro

BLoomberg Steinhoff International Holdings NV, the global retailer fighting to recover from an accounting scandal, sold its luxury Gulfstream 550 private jet to a US aircraft broker as it seeks to boost liquidity.
